Assembly is where a design either survives contact with the production floor or quietly does not. Crimp height, strip length, shield termination and routing discipline are boring variables that decide field failure rates — and they are exactly the variables a trading company cannot control.
Process steps.
Material release
Cable, contacts, housings and auxiliaries confirmed against the approved specification before they reach the line.
Wire preparation
Cut to length, strip, tin, twist and terminate to the build definition.
Termination
Crimping, soldering or IDC, with crimp height verified at setup and in process.
Assembly
Routing, branching, sleeving, braid or foil shielding, labeling and securing.
Molding / potting
Overmold or potting where the design requires it.
Verification
Electrical, dimensional and visual checkpoints against the agreed test scope.
Pack & release
Labeling, packing and documentation to the agreed delivery requirement.
Workmanship standard.
Production is built to IPC/WHMA-A-620 Class 3 workmanship criteria unless your drawing specifies otherwise. Crimp height, pull force and visual acceptance are defined per project and confirmed during quotation, not discovered at final inspection.
Practical note: we state Class 3 as the workmanship criteria we build and inspect to. If your program requires a certificate of compliance issued by a certified IPC training centre, tell us at quotation and we will confirm exactly what can be supplied rather than discovering it at delivery.
